Pearl GTL is the world’s largest plant to turn natural gas into cleaner-burning fuels. It is making steady progress in ramping up production, after selling first commercial shipment of GTL Gasoil in June 2011. The plant will help to meet the world’s growing demand for cleaner energy. Pearl GTL is a world-scale project located in Ras Laffan Industrial City, 80 km north of Doha, Qatar.
The world's largest plant to turn natural gas into cleaner-burning fuels and lubricants, Pearl GTL, is moving towards full production.
The Pearl team checked thousands of pieces of equipment as they worked to breathe life into the plant.
Through teamwork and an imaginative approach to training that, the Pearl GTL project set a safety record.
Shell and Qatar Petroleum achieved record times for drilling wells in Qatar’s North Field at the Pearl GTL project.
Water is a resource that is hard to come by in Qatar’s desert climate. The Pearl GTL plant will produce at least as much water as gas-to-liquids products.
Pearl Village is a 170-acre residential area built to house the huge number of contractor staff who constructed Pearl GTL.
